  • Dangers of EM radiation
    • As the frquency of EM waves increases, so does the energy.
    • EM waves with a high frequency have the ability to knock electrons off atoms
    • referred to as ionising
  • Dangers of IR radiation
    • Can cause skin burns
    • Risk can be reduced by wearing insulating materials
  • Dangers of UV radiation
    • Can damage cells and cause blindness
    • Permanently damages cells in the retina of the eye.
    • Risks can be reduced by avoiding eye contact with the sun and wearing appropriate sunscreen outside
  • Dangers of X-Rays
    • Can cause damage to cells
    • and lead to cancers
    • However, levels of x-rays used in medical procedures is very small and poses almost no risk
  • Dangers of Gamma Radiation
    • Vey dangerous
    • The most ionising out of EM radiation
    • Can penetrate deep into the body, causing cell damage and cancers
    • Sources should be kept in lead-lined containers to minimise their risk
